Best 97223 Oregon Public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 6 public schools serving 2,586 students in 97223, OR (there are 10 private schools, serving 2,031 private students). 56% of all K-12 students in 97223, OR are educated in public schools (compared to the OR state average of 90%).
The top-ranked public schools in 97223, OR are Montclair Elementary School, Mary Woodward Elementary School and Charles F Tigard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 97223 have an average math proficiency score of 39% (versus the Oregon public school average of 31%), and reading proficiency score of 48% (versus the 44% statewide average). Schools in 97223, OR have an average ranking of 8/10, which is in the top 30% of Oregon public schools.
Minority enrollment is 48%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the Oregon public school average of 43% (majority Hispanic).
